Winter is here, and a lot of people have started complaining about joint pain, regardless of age.

However, there isn’t a particular scientific theory that can signify the primary cause behind the problem.

But the Orthopedic Surgery Specialists Patna states that the joint pain occurs due to drops in barometric pressure.

Moreover, the decline in pressure causes tissue, muscles, and tendons to expand, leading to joint pain.

Note: The doctor suggested this based on research and studies. However, it isn’t the only cause for knee, shoulder, ankle, and finger joints to hurt when cold.

4 Joint Pain Relief Tips for Winter

Here are the best tips for relieving joint pain during the winter months:

#1. Exercise Daily

Performing exercise to manage joint pain is contradictory as some think it can increase pain, and some think the opposite.

According to professionals, it’s important to exercise regularly during the winter as it helps to reduce joint pain and stiffness.

Studies show that people suffering from arthritis or other bone disease needs to practice exercises, especially in the winter.

So, if you want to start it, try low-impact activities such as swimming, walking, yoga, and more.

Furthermore, exercises can help improve flexibility and strengthen the muscles around your joints, which can help reduce pain and stiffness.

Always remember not to overdo or push your limits while exercising, as it harm you more and increases joint pain.

#2. Follow a Balanced Diet

Following a healthy balanced diet is always the best choice for managing the body’s overall health.

There are several reasons for joint pain, regardless of season, but one of the major ones is not having proper/enough nutrients to make bones and joints strong.

Studies show that following a diet including fresh fruits, vegetables, and healthy fats can help reduce and improve overall joint health.

Moreover, these foods provide all the nutrients required to build and maintain healthy bones and joints.

Also, following a healthy balanced diet can help you prevent several joint problems or diseases which may happen in the future (as you age).

#3. Take Calcium and Vitamin D

From the above section, you can understand the importance of taking proper nutrients to build and maintain healthy and strong bones.

However, many people are suffering from a lack of two essential nutrients for bones; calcium and vitamin D.

We all know that bones are made up of calcium, and it isn’t necessary to tell you the importance of it. So, it’s recommended to take the proper amount of calcium.

What if you’re taking enough of it, but your body doesn’t absorb it properly?

You won’t get any benefit, right? Don’t worry! Vitamin D can help you get the most calcium from your diet.

According to research, vitamin D is an essential nutrient for bones as it helps them to absorb the proper amount of calcium.

#4. Maintain a Healthy Weight

Maintaining a healthy weight is the key to manage pain and improve the overall condition of the joint, especially in winter months.

Being overweight or obese can put extra stress on your joints and the cartilage (which protects the ends of your bones), especially your knees, hips, and lower back.

Moreover, it can lead to pain and discomfort. Also, it can lead to severe joint problems as you age.

Furthermore, studies shoes that extra fat can also increase the levels of some chemicals that results in the inflammation of joint.

Therefore, it’s essential to Lose weight as it can help reduce the strain (extra pressure) on your joints and improve your overall condition.

You must practice regular exercises and follow a balanced diet to lose or maintain a healthy weight. You can also consult a professional.
